How to Promote in Pinterest: A Comprehensive Guide

In today’s digital age, Pinterest has emerged as a powerful platform for businesses and individuals to showcase their products, services, and ideas. With millions of active users, Pinterest offers a unique opportunity to reach a highly engaged audience. Whether you’re a small business owner, a content creator, or a social media influencer, promoting your content on Pinterest can significantly boost your online presence. In this article, we will discuss various strategies to help you promote effectively on Pinterest.

1. Optimize Your Pinterest Profile

Before diving into promoting your content, it’s crucial to optimize your Pinterest profile. Create a compelling profile picture, write a captivating bio, and link your website or blog. Make sure your profile is complete and reflects your brand’s personality.

2. Create High-Quality Pins

Pinterest is a visual platform, so investing in high-quality pins is essential. Use vibrant images and videos that stand out from the crowd. Ensure your pins are relevant to your target audience and include keywords in the pin descriptions. This will help your pins appear in search results and increase their visibility.

3. Use Rich Pins

Rich Pins provide more information about your content directly on the pin. There are various types of rich pins, such as product pins, article pins, and recipe pins. By using rich pins, you can provide a more engaging experience for your audience and increase the likelihood of them clicking on your pins.

4. Join Pinterest Group Boards

Group boards are a great way to increase your reach on Pinterest. Find relevant group boards in your niche and request to join them. Once you’re part of a group board, you can contribute pins and gain exposure to a broader audience.

5. Collaborate with Influencers

Influencers on Pinterest have a strong following and can help you reach a larger audience. Collaborate with influencers in your niche by inviting them to create pins for your products or content. This can help you tap into their audience and gain credibility.

6. Use Pinterest Ads

Pinterest offers a variety of advertising options to help you promote your content. You can create promoted pins, which appear in search results and on users’ home feeds. Use targeted keywords, interests, and demographics to reach the right audience.

7. Engage with Your Audience

Engaging with your audience is crucial for building a strong presence on Pinterest. Respond to comments on your pins, participate in discussions, and share user-generated content. This will help you build a loyal following and encourage more engagement with your pins.

8. Track Your Performance

Pinterest provides analytics tools to help you track the performance of your pins and campaigns. Use these tools to analyze your data, identify what works, and optimize your strategy accordingly. Regularly monitoring your performance will help you refine your approach and improve your results.

By following these strategies, you can effectively promote your content on Pinterest and reach a highly engaged audience. Remember that consistency and creativity are key to success on this platform. Keep experimenting with different approaches and stay up-to-date with the latest trends to maximize your reach and impact.
